1. What is the functional group associated with organic acids?

Explanation

The functional group associated with organic acids is the carboxyl group, which consists of a carbonyl group bonded to a hydroxyl group.

2. What is the functional group known as sulhydryl and what properties does it exhibit?

Explanation

Sulhydryl groups consist of a sulfur atom bonded to a hydrogen atom and are important for forming disulfide bonds in proteins, contributing to their structure and stability. The other three options are different functional groups with distinct properties and roles in biological molecules.

3. What are steroids?

Explanation

Steroids are a specific type of lipid composed of four fused rings and play a crucial role in regulating cellular activities as hormones. Proteins, carbohydrates, and nucleic acids are different types of biomolecules with distinct structures and functions.

4. What does the change in free energy represent?

Explanation

The correct answer is that the change in free energy represents the maximum useful work obtainable from a process. It is a measure of the energy available to do work.
